The problem: when i log into my hotmail.com account, I am asked to re-enter the password over and over again, without actually having access to my account. The password is correct, since if I enter the wrong password I get the wrong-password answer. What happens is that I am simply asked to re-enter the password as if my session was become invalid. OK. I have read the FAQ about the cookies, dynamic page contents etc., so I have a clue about all the problems that cookie related pages yield. So I have the following settings on my GNU/Linux-I386 box + mozilla browser (with no browser cache):

DontCache: all hotmail/msn/passport.com related sites;
try-without-password: set to "no".

It doesn't work though. I would like to know if I am missing something, if there is some other setting, or, which is best, how to deal correctly with sites of that kind??
In yahoo I eventually log in, I get the cached page (that may belong to a different account!!) and after a refresh I get the right page.
